Transaction 4c8ca13e58bdda7d3c39b125cea13286460081392a41b607cb79c8c4c6733640
1 Input
1 Output
-
4c8ca13e58bdda7d3c39b125cea13286460081392a41b607cb79c8c4c6733640:0
- value
- 399997836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d8e22d9387fb327987f810824e737bb7757738b OP_EQUAL
- address
- 3LRtifFGQeAB6DBJuxTFLKRpNEWU5RGFn5